  • How you scale your #business is dependent on your mindset.
    Unlock Your Business Potential with the 5 Levels of Success
    Professional: professional who gets 10 strangers to become clients. Also defined as product-market fit.
    Self-employed: professional is the operational magic in the business. Build and deliver operating model. Scaling the skillset of the founder.
    Business Owner: The professional is the operational driver of the business. Starts to scale the business to multiple access points, stores, or branches. Start to develop a management team, but the management structure is flat. Scaling the mindset of the founder.
    Entrepreneur: Business owner focuses their energy on developing a culture that is supported by strong, robust processes to enable the business to scale. Focus also extends to defining a strong vision for the business that transcends profits together with a clear strategy and aligning that strategy with plans (short-term incentives). Developing a framework to build institutional trust.
    Founder: The entrepreneur has successfully built a business that can operate without their daily direction. Focuses their energy on creating a legacy, building an exit plan, succession planning and scaling trust.
